Statement
Stones are where my work starts. I use natural stones, as well as crystalline and stone shapes, which I make from other materials like wood or plastic. My work consists of sorting and grouping-I arrange and re-arrange, create regularities, disorder and exceptions…Precious stones always possess a sense of glamour and secrecy…My jewelry is colorful but not brightly colored. Differences in colors and materials produce moods, which I have sought to capture.
CV
1971 born in Göttingen, Germany
1991 - 1994 Goldsmithingschool, Pforzheim, Germany
1994 - 1999 Faculty of Design, Technical College Pforzheim, Germany,
Jewellery and Everyday Objects Design
1999 - 2000 One-year-fellowship, DAAD (Deutscher Akademischer Austauschdienst)
2003 - 2004 Visiting lecturer, Technical college Idar-Oberstein,
Applied Art: Gemstone and Objectdesign
2005 - 2006 Fellowship, Fonds voor Beeldende Kunsten, Amsterdam
since 2006 lives and works in Berlin, Germany
